Illegal streaming: demand for illegal copies of movies on the rise, according to Akamai

In its “State of the Internet” report, content delivery network operator Akamai Technologies has confirmed a sharp increase in the illegal downloading of movies. Illegal file sharing has increased sharply again due to the multitude of streaming services and increased prices, it said.

Sharp increase in digital streams and downloads

According to Akamai‘s report, between January 2021 and September 2021, the demand for illegal movie services worldwide increased to 3.7 billion streams and downloads. These break down into illegal torrents and websites that allow streaming of movies and TV series directly in the browser or via an app.

He said 61.5 percent of all hits to a website with illegal content occurred directly on the site, with 28.6 percent of all visitors specifically searching for a specific movie or series. For the measurement, Akami partnered with Muso, a British company that deals with illegal file sharing, he said.

According to James Mason, chief technology officer of Muso, there was a 16 percent growth in this regard compared to the previous nine-month period. In total, a full 132 billion views of illegal copy websites were recorded between January and September 2021.

Germany no longer in the top 5

The U.S. leads the way with 13.5 billion hits, followed by Russia with 7.2 billion, India (6.5 billion), China (5.9 billion) and Brazil (4.5 billion). Germany previously held the top position, but is now on the decline.

For lawyer Christian Solmecke, however, this is no reason for reassurance, as he revealed on YouTube. He expects the next big wave in file sharing, which has flattened out considerably over the past ten years, but is now seeing a rapid rise again.

He speaks of a “veritable renaissance of peer-to-peer networking”, which he attributes to the increased number of streaming services such as Netflix, Disney+ and co, as well as the ever-increasing prices.
